Main local history museum in the old granary, covering mining, winter sports, and the town’s development through the centuries.
Museum branch on Kitzbühel’s sporting identity, highlighting the Hahnenkamm race and famous local ski champions.
Regional heritage collection in nearby St. Johann, useful for broader context on Tyrolean culture, crafts, and rural life.
Kitzbühel’s colorful medieval old town street, lined with historic façades, boutiques, and postcard views.
Elegant main street through the center, ideal for strolling among historic buildings and the town’s signature alpine atmosphere.
Iconic mountain and ski area with broad views, summer trails, and access to the famous Streif race course.
A clear Tyrolean beef broth served with sliced pancake strips. It is a classic Alpine starter found in inns across Tirol.
Cheese dumplings made with bread, Alpine cheese, onions, and herbs, often served in broth or with salad. A beloved Tyrolean mountain dish.
A hearty pan-fried mix of potatoes, onions, and cured meat, traditionally eaten in Tirol as warming farmhouse fare after skiing or hiking.
Awarded fine dining in the Tennerhof hotel, known for refined Austrian cuisine, seasonal tasting menus, and an elegant setting.
An established upscale restaurant serving modern Austrian cooking with strong wine focus in a polished but relaxed setting.
A traditional Tyrolean inn known for local classics, dumplings, schnitzel, and a cozy historic atmosphere near the center.
Very high versus many Austrian towns: lodging, ski dining, and resort services cost more, while local buses and trains are reasonable.
Service is usually included, but rounding up is standard. Add about 5-10% in restaurants, round up for taxis, and leave small change in cafes.
